I’ve been hunting for deals on the Garmin Fenix in particular, with three generations of the sports watch worth looking out for in the sales.
Originally released in 2019, the Garmin Fenix 6 Pro is old, but still an excellent sports watch with maps and music storage—the standard Fenix 6 is also good, but lacks maps, which I consider a key part of the Fenix line’s appeal.
The Garmin Fenix 7 came out in early 2022 and is still up to date with all of Garmin’s software features, some of which launched with the Garmin Fenix 7 Pro in 2023 but then rolled back to the 7.
There are some hardware differences between the Fenix 7 and 7 Pro though. The Fenix 7 Pro has a better heart rate sensor than the Fenix 7, and all sizes and versions of the Pro have built-in flashlights and multi-band GPS, whereas with the 7 only the 7X has a flashlight and only sapphire models have multi-band GPS.
